iPhone & Android App: The specialized app works on both iPhone and Android devices. Inside, you've got control over nearly everything! The color-wheel allows you virtually infinite control over the exact hue and intensity of your RGB accessories. Adjustable Fade, Strobe, and pre-programmed color-changing themes provide a handful of special effects to spice it up. If you've got a few favorite combinations, you can save them to your favorites list and load 'em up again later with ease!

Three Zone: The XBT Bluetooth Controller is capable of controlling up to three different zones/pairs of RGB accessories. Two pairs of halos and a set of Demon eyes? No problem. Demon eyes, strips, and halos? You bet. You can apply a different color or effect to each zone, or lock them together to easily apply the same settings across the board. If you can wire it, Morimoto RGB Controller can control it!

Legalize It: If you like green, that's great! but it just so happens that white and amber are the only colors that are street-legal inside your headlights. For your safety and convenience - whenever the XBT System powers up (aka whenever you turn your vehicle on) - it defaults the output to white. So when you hop in the car in morning and head off to work - you don't have to worry about pulling up to the parking deck with your headlights still in rave mode because you hadn't had any coffee yet. But once you're parked, anything goes. With the flick of a finger you have full access to every color under the sun.

Plug-n-Play: Unlike other options out there that require DIY wiring from the user's side, the XBT Bluetooth Controller is 100% Plug-n-Play. There is no wire stripping, cutting, or splicing involved. Optional JST Connectors: In the event that your RGB accessories DO require custom wiring, the optional JST pins/connectors make quick work of a clean install. Crimp, insert, and go!
